Hair Pomade is a must have these days especially if you have unruly or curly hair. So, what’s wrong if we have more than one variations right?

Ingredients

Beeswax – 3 Tsp.
Glycerin – 1 Tbsp. (Optional)
Vitamin E Oil – 1 Tbsp.
Argan Oil – 3 Tsp.
Infused Oil – 120 Ml
Essential Oil – as needed

Instructions

Melt the Beeswax in your double boiler.

Once melted remove from heat and add all the other ingredients – start with infused oil and finally Essential Oil and Argan Oil.

Mix and transfer to sterilized dispensers.

Done!

Tips to Tweak the Recipe

You can also use Lanolin or other waxes including Soy Wax, Candelila Wax or Carnauba Wax. Candelila Wax gives a glossy finish, if that’s not your preference, go with some other option.

To add volume you can try adding Silicone to your recipe, though adding Avocado Oil gives similar result. So, try that before you opt for Silicone or by-products.

Infused Oil – You could choose herbs, flowers or even aromatic ingredients like Vanilla here. The idea is to make the oil multipurpose. I have tried Vanilla, Lavender, Rosemary, Coffee, etc. I chose Vanilla for gifting and Coffee or Rosemary for hair care. However, you can also use carrier oil without infusing and use Essential Oils to add aroma to the recipe.

Glycerin is optional and I don’t use it that often in the recipe. It’s optional and needed if you have dry hair or scalp. But if the atmosphere is too humid or moist it is counterproductive and being in a tropical place it doesn’t work for me. But you can give it a shot and see how it works for you.

You can add Essential Oils when you haven’t used any aromatic ingredients in the infused oil. When using Coffee or Vanilla, or even Lavender, you won’t need essential oils for most part.

You can use any oil for infusing – Jojoba Oil, Coconut Oil, Sunflower Oil, Sweet Almond Oil, etc. Make sure all the ingredients you use are natural, organic and non-GMO.

You don’t need to whisk this recipe but it’s your choice. Pomade is usually dense and you can keep it light or dense based on the hold you’re going for – vary the oil – wax ratio according to your preference. This one is fairly lighter and easy to apply when rubbed between your fingers for warming up.

How to Use the Pomade?

Take a small dollop of the pomade and apply on your strands. Style as usual.
